One in four people w... how many members are there in skzWebApr 7, 2015 · Bionic Eye: Two ApproachesMARC Multiple Unit Artificial Retina Chipset The images are captured by an external camera. Processed and then transmitted to an implant on the retina. This in-turn will transmit it to the ganglion cells and then to the optic nerve.
